It could be that the world builder ini file has something wrong in it like to big x and y axis.This is my ini file, compare it to yours. You will find it in: C:\Users\[USERNAME]\Documents\Command and Conquer Generals Zero Hour Data Its called worldbuilder.ini This is my ini file, compare it to yours: [GameOptions] cloudMap=0 Default Map Height=16 Default Map X-size=100 Default Map Y-size=100 Default Map Border=30 [GroveOptions] DefaultRatio1=0 DefaultRatio2=0 DefaultRatio3=0 DefaultRatio4=0 DefaultRatio5=0 [OptionsWindow] Top=88 Left=999 [MainFrame] Top=-3 Left=-3 AutoSave=1 AutoSaveIntervalSeconds=120 ShowTopDownView=0 [MapOpenSavePanel] UseSystemDir=0 [PickUnitWindow] Top=131 Left=769 [MainFrame-Summary] Bars=0 ScreenCX=1366 ScreenCY=768 [WorldbuilderApp] OpenDirectory=C:\Users\[[color=red]CENCORED[/color]]\Desktop\ [ScriptDialog] Top=53 Left=150 AutoVerifyScripts=0 [Recent File List]
